python3 写一个函数,求一个字符串的长度,在main函数中输入字符串,并输出其长度

qq_40666405 2017-11-01 02:57:43
新人,希望得到帮助!谢谢了
...全文
1201 2 打赏 收藏 举报
写回复
2 条回复
切换为时间正序
当前发帖距今超过3年,不再开放新的回复
发表回复
引用 1 楼 MoMo_Goder 的回复:
#!/usr/bin/python3
import sys

def my_strlen(mystr):
    return len(mystr)

def main(argv):
    l = len(sys.argv)
    if l != 2:
        print("usage:len.py mystr")
        return
    mystr = sys.argv[1]
    mylen = my_strlen(mystr)
    print("输入字符串长度:", mylen)

if __name__=='__main__':
    main(sys.argv[1:])
话说回来其实获取字符串的长度只需要用len(str)函数即可;
根据你的需求对上面的代码做些修改:
#!/usr/bin/python3
import sys

def my_strlen(mystr):
    return len(mystr)

if __name__=='__main__':
    mystr = input("请输入字符串:")
    mylen = my_strlen(mystr)
    print("输入字符串长度:", mylen)
  • 打赏
  • 举报
回复
#!/usr/bin/python3
import sys

def my_strlen(mystr):
    return len(mystr)

def main(argv):
    l = len(sys.argv)
    if l != 2:
        print("usage:len.py mystr")
        return
    mystr = sys.argv[1]
    mylen = my_strlen(mystr)
    print("输入字符串长度:", mylen)

if __name__=='__main__':
    main(sys.argv[1:])
话说回来其实获取字符串的长度只需要用len(str)函数即可;
  • 打赏
  • 举报
回复
相关推荐
发帖
脚本语言
加入

3.7w+

社区成员

JavaScript,VBScript,AngleScript,ActionScript,Shell,Perl,Ruby,Lua,Tcl,Scala,MaxScript 等脚本语言交流。
社区管理员
  • 脚本语言(Perl/Python)社区
  • ITBOB • 鲍勃
申请成为版主
帖子事件
创建了帖子
2017-11-01 02:57
社区公告

CSDN 脚本语言社区接受专栏投稿(专栏会在顶部创建专属你的栏目),投稿需满足以下要求:

  • 脚本语言技术相关;
  • 文章持续更新,保持活跃;
  • 内容清晰明了,干货为主;
  • 文章排版有序,有条有理。

本社区开通招聘专栏,发布招聘信息请联系版主,发布者需要保证招聘信息真实有效,CSDN 平台和版主不对招聘内容负责!

联系方式:私聊版主、发送邮件、QQ联系等均可: